用户
 找回密码
 入住 CI 中国社区
搜索
查看: 6747|回复: 7
收起左侧

[HELP] 手机访问网站时如何获取IP地址?

[复制链接]
发表于 2013-12-2 15:30:35 | 显示全部楼层 |阅读模式
本帖最后由 ′放肆√の-青 于 2013-12-2 15:33 编辑

$_SERVER['REMOTE_ADDR'];
这样获取到的IP地址在电脑上可以,但是在手机网站上获取到的IP地址总是跟所在地不一样,有时候相差很大。用自己的手机试过了,手机在北京访问,IP地址显示天津。。。
我试过用$this->input->ip_address();  还有网上的获取IP函数,结果都是一样,有没有更好的办法获取到手机访问网站时的准确IP地址?
CIer  发表于 2013-12-2 15:39:30
IP地址?手机是没有IP地址的!因为手机使用的是运营商的发射的网络型号!
发表于 2013-12-2 22:31:12 | 显示全部楼层
许多都是浏览器厂商的代理服务器地址。
发表于 2013-12-3 05:10:31 | 显示全部楼层
手机上网显示的都是真实的IP地址。

要控制手机在北京访问,IP地址显示亦必定是北京,可收购手机公司,当了老板后,作出相应规定。
 楼主| 发表于 2013-12-3 09:23:12 | 显示全部楼层
dren_a 发表于 2013-12-2 22:31
许多都是浏览器厂商的代理服务器地址。

{:soso_e117:}那岂不是没有办法获取到所在地的IP地址了。。。
 楼主| 发表于 2013-12-3 09:23:52 | 显示全部楼层
燃雲 发表于 2013-12-3 05:10
手机上网显示的都是真实的IP地址。

要控制手机在北京访问,IP地址显示亦必定是北京,可收购手机公司,当了 ...

我只是个程序员,太看得起我了。。。{:soso_e117:}
 楼主| 发表于 2013-12-3 09:24:41 | 显示全部楼层
匿名者 发表于 2013-12-2 15:39
IP地址?手机是没有IP地址的!因为手机使用的是运营商的发射的网络型号!

这样子获取到的IP地址都是假的?
发表于 2013-12-4 14:59:11 | 显示全部楼层
可能是代理的IP吧

本版积分规则